Embrace Your Uniqueness: Why Not Being Everyone’s Favorite is Your Superpower

In a world where the pressure to fit in often feels overwhelming, we can easily forget the most liberating truth: You don’t have to be loved by everyone. It’s easy to feel lost when we try to meet every expectation or live up to the standards set by others. But here’s the truth that many don’t want to hear — you are not meant to be everyone’s favorite, and that’s absolutely okay.
The sooner you embrace this, the sooner you’ll step into a more authentic, fulfilled version of yourself.
The Trap of Seeking Universal Approval
Since childhood, many of us are taught that being liked, fitting in, and pleasing others is the key to happiness. We spend years striving for approval, molding ourselves into versions that we think will be acceptable to others. But this constant pursuit of external validation leads to a life of exhaustion and confusion. It’s impossible to please everyone, and trying to do so only leads to frustration, self-doubt, and a loss of personal identity.
